Burrito - heat beans, spread on tortilla, sprinkle on cheddar cheese. Heat in microwave for 25 seconds. Add onions, tomatoes, shredded lettuce, close and flip. Heat picante sauce or salsa and pour over the top. Put a dollop of fat free sour cream or Fage 0 Greek yogurt on top of that. Eat with a fork and spoon.0

throw them in any tomatoe based soup recipe,chili,vegatable,barley. thickens and adds a level of flavor0

A friend of mine used to always make this dip for parties, usually Superbowl parties, that she just called "super dip". I know the base was refried beans and there was cream cheese in it. I googled it and found this which sounds pretty close...

I also like to just layer: refried beans, taco meat, cheese and salsa and microwave it till cheese is melty and then serve it with chips as sort of deconstructed nachos.0 -
